SIMPLE FAITH
(A tribute to a friend’s mother and a wonderful Christian lady.)
We said Goodbye to Muriel today, Friends and family frozen In the harsh light, Familiar faces drawn so pale with nervous pain.
Yet there was joy, real joy That broke the grey sky’s shell And came to dwell among us! The kindly priest, white robed Spoke of a life lived with a simple faith A smile that rested- from an undivided heart Trust of a child that followed all the way A hand held out to grasp and still held on Throughout the darker, desperate days.
She was her own small sermon Loving in her warm and simple way And shining with her rays of certainty Into the deep sad doubt of other souls.
The smile that said it all, And they all spoke of that And when the light streamed in, we felt Her smile had lit the room And she was home.
© Pauline Griffiths
